



Sarah's Field
Sarah’s Field was gifted to the town by, Mrs Pamela Angela Thorpe, for the enjoyment of the residents of Berkeley. A condition of the gift is to make the area a Wildlife Water Meadow. Mrs Thorpe also asked the council to name the field after her Grandmother Sarah. The field was formerly known as Lynch Ground.
The area, located on Lynch Road, now boasts a pond and small marshland area, a dipping platform, benches, native plants and trees, close mown paths, fences, gates, bins and information boards. The council has appointed Stroud Valleys Project to manage and maintain the area helped out by volunteers.
